Christine Feehan is a powerhouse in the paranormal romance genre, and her novels have captivated readers for years. While her books are incredibly popular, there hasn’t been a major film adaptation of her works yet. However, her 'Dark' series, which revolves around the Carpathians, a race of immortal beings, has all the elements to make a fantastic movie or TV series. The rich world-building, intense romance, and supernatural action would translate beautifully to the screen.
Fans have been eagerly waiting for news of an adaptation, and with the recent surge in popularity of paranormal and fantasy series like 'Twilight' and 'Shadow and Bone,' it feels like only a matter of time before one of her books gets picked up. Until then, we can only imagine how stunning a 'Dark' series adaptation would be, with its brooding heroes, strong heroines, and intricate plots. The potential for a cinematic universe is huge, and I’d love to see it happen.

Christine Feehan's 'Dark Series' is a staple in my reading list. The series has indeed expanded beyond the main books with several spin-offs that dive deeper into its rich universe. 'Dark Hunger' is a graphic novel spin-off that brings a fresh visual dimension to the Carpathians' world, focusing on the character Riordan. Then there's 'Dark Crime,' a novella that blends the Dark and GhostWalker series, offering a crossover treat for fans.
Another notable mention is 'Dark Melody,' which, while part of the main series, introduces elements that feel almost spin-off-like with its intense focus on a single couple's journey. For those craving more, Feehan's short stories in anthologies like 'Dark Dreamers' also expand the lore. Each spin-off adds layers to the original series, making the Carpathian world even more immersive and thrilling to explore.
